AlexeyUkaTM6
Junior Member / Новичок
Участник № / Member № 2002
отправлено / posted 10-10-2011 15:19
Такой вопрос. Требуется отфильтровать архив событий по разным параметрам и то что получилось вывести на печать. Кто как сие процедуру проделывает? В ТМ5 делалось простым нажатием двух кнопок CTRL+P, здесь не всё так просто. Приходится писать свой обработчик, конвертировать текстовый файл в базу данных, написать оболочку для работы с ней и затем уж печать. Может кто подскажет "красивое решение" данной проблемы, по форуму ничего подробного не нашёл, неужели никто не распечатывает отчёт тревог в нужном виде?
Сообщения / Posts 4 | Из / From: Казахстан
| IP / IP: IP адрес / IP address |
отправлено / posted 10-10-2011 15:41
Из справочной системы: "В МРВ: для сохранения видимого экрана в файл …/<папка узла>/<ID шаблона>_<ID канала>.png нужно послать 2 в атрибут 254, RST соответствующего канала CALL.Screen." Файл можно распечатать.
Сообщения / Posts 17400 | Из / From: Россия
| IP / IP: IP адрес / IP address |
AlexeyUkaTM6
Junior Member / Новичок
Участник № / Member № 2002
отправлено / posted 11-10-2011 08:43
Попробую конечно, но всё равно неудобно, оператора теперь придется обучить как выйти из полноэкранного режима, найти созданный файл, чтобы его потом распечатать. Либо придумать, как по нажатию кнопки ТМ запускать этот файл.
Сообщения / Posts 4 | Из / From: Казахстан
| IP / IP: IP адрес / IP address |
отправлено / posted 11-10-2011 10:30
Для запуска процедуры печати можно использовать CALL с типом вызова EXEC.
Сообщения / Posts 17400 | Из / From: Россия
| IP / IP: IP адрес / IP address |